Printed from the Society, Religion and Technology Project website:

Longitude Prize 2014

image Published: Jun 10, 2014

Read the BBC News article on the Longitude Prize to encourage inventors and scientists to find solutions to six key problems facing the world.

BBC News

Printed from on Wed, February 20, 2019
© The Church of Scotland 2019